Jana Sena Party office inaugurated

Pawan Kalyan offers prayers to mother India, deities

The office of Jana Sena Party was inaugurated in Hyderabad on Tuesday. The inauguration was done by the party chief and founder Pawan Kalyan who offered prayers to mother India and then the deities of various other religions.

The party is growing in Andhra Pradesh and Telangana and would function from the Hyderabad office where a digital team will also be present, a press release from the party office stated.

Pawan Kalyan's close associate and film director Trivikram, producer D. Suresh Babu, industrialists, advocates, CAs, educationists and others were present.
